Amplified 2015 Translator's Notes:
Literal renderings, alternate translations or explanations.
1
Phoebe ("bright," "pure") was chosen by Paul as his emissary to deliver this letter to Rome. She may have held a recognized position within the church.
2
Cenchrea, a few miles east of Corinth, served as Corinth's port and was probably visited by Paul during both his second and third missionary journeys. This letter was written from Corinth near the end of the third journey.
